Snowcityshop

Snowcityshop is an online-only retailer specializing in winter-sports apparel and hard goods for skiing, snowboarding and après-ski. Core categories include insulated jackets and pants ($120-$450), merino base layers ($45-$90), goggles and helmets ($60-$250), plus a small selection of entry-level skis and snowboards ($300-$550). The entire catalog sits in the mid-range price band, positioned below premium alpine brands but above discount chains. The company’s house-label gear uses recycled DWR-treated shells, bluesign-approved insulation and magnetic goggle-lock systems—features normally found at 30-40 % higher price points. Their “Color-Block Alpine” jacket line, restocked annually since 2019, routinely sells out within two weeks and drives 45 % of site traffic. Free 48-hour U.S. shipping and a 60-day “snow-tested” return window reinforce the value promise. Customers are 18-35-year-old resort riders who ride 5-15 days a season and want technical performance without pro-level price tags. The brand’s TikTok and Discord community emphasize progression over perfection, showcasing user-generated clips of park beginners and weekend car-campers. Sustainability messaging—recycled fabrics, carbon-neutral shipping—aligns with buyers who offset flights to the mountains. Snowcityshop competes against direct-to-consumer winter brands that also skip wholesale mark-ups, but it differentiates through faster drop cycles (new colorways every 30 days) and bundled kits (jacket + goggle + helmet at 15 % off). By limiting SKUs to proven bestsellers and reordering in small batches, it keeps inventory lean and prices roughly 20 % below comparable technical specs.

Omorpho

Omorpho sells gravity-loaded training apparel—compression tops, shorts, leggings, and vests that carry small, strategically placed weights—priced in the premium tier: $95-$195 for tops and $145-$245 for leggings. The collection is sold direct-to-consumer through omorpho.com and the brand’s mobile app; no wholesale or brick-and-mortar inventory is maintained, although pop-up try-on events appear in major cities. The brand’s MicroLoad system bonds ¼- to ¾-ounce micro-weights into performance mesh, adding 2-10 lb of load without bulky plates or vests. Athletes can train with lighter external weight while maintaining neuromuscular stimulus, a concept Omorpho markets as “train lower, go higher.” The G-Vest+ (5-10 lb adjustable weighted vest) and G-Short (2.5 lb total) are the most cited products in media coverage and team-sport adoption. Primary buyers are 18-40-year-old runners, HIIT athletes, and tactical professionals who want sport-specific overload without changing movement mechanics. The brand frames gravity as “free resistance,” appealing to data-driven exercisers who track wattage, split times, and vertical leap and value minimalist gear that travels from gym to track. Omorpho competes in the small weighted-vest niche and the broader performance-apparel space; it differentiates by embedding micro-loads in tailored, sweat-wicking garments rather than using adjustable pockets or elastic straps. This positions it between fashion-forward athleisure and hardcore strength equipment, offering a wearable resistance tool that looks like premium training kit rather than rehab gear.

RunDNA

RunDNA is an Australian specialty retailer focused on running footwear, apparel and accessories. Core categories are performance running shoes (AUD 180-320), technical apparel (AUD 60-180) and wearable gait-analysis devices (AUD 299-499), placing the brand in the mid-to-premium tier. Sales are handled through the rundna.com.au e-commerce site and a single biomechanics lab/flagship store in Sydney. The company differentiates itself by combining retail with lab-grade gait testing: every shoe purchase can be matched to a 3-D foot scan and pressure-plate assessment captured in-store or via a mailed kit. Its private-label “DNA Runner” shoe line is built on data from these scans, offered in multiple midsole stiffness options that are selected algorithmically. RunDNA also licenses its wearable stride sensors to physiotherapy clinics, giving the brand a dual presence in retail and rehab. Primary customers are sub-elite and committed recreational runners logging 40–100 km per week who view injury prevention as important as speed. They value evidence-based fitting over fashion and are willing to pay extra for customised support; the typical buyer is 25-45, urban, and already uses GPS watches or training apps. RunDNA competes with both large multi-brand sports chains and niche run-specialty stores. It separates itself by positioning as a “running health” company rather than a pure retailer: the in-house biomechanics data, medical-channel sensor sales and modular shoe construction create a tech-driven moat that standard inventory-based competitors do not replicate.

Solova Move

Solova Move sells fold-flat, single-speed city bicycles and matching accessories—kickstands, carry bags, helmets, and reflective straps—priced in the USD 350-550 band, squarely mid-range among direct-to-consumer folders. Everything is sold exclusively through solovamove.com; no dealer network or third-party marketplaces are used. The brand’s core promise is a true 10-second fold that leaves the chain facing inward, keeping clothes clean and letting the bike stand vertically like a briefcase. At 11.8 kg the aluminum frame is among the lightest in its price class, and the magnetic clasp keeps the package locked shut without extra levers. All models ship tool-free and ride on puncture-resistant 20" tires branded with Solova’s repeating chevron pattern. Buyers are 25-45-year-old urban commuters who live in apartments <60 m² and combine subway, ride-share, or office elevator segments with a sub-2 km last-mile ride. They value minimal upkeep, clean aesthetics, and the ability to stash the bike behind a door or under a desk; Instagram posts tagged #solovamove show the folded bike next to carry-on luggage, emphasizing fly-weight portability. Solova competes with mainstream folder makers that rely on multi-speed drivetrains and heavier steel frames sold through bike shops. By pairing a grease-free belt-style chain guard, single-speed simplicity, and flat-fold geometry with mid-range pricing and DTC convenience, Solova positions itself as the low-maintenance, apartment-friendly alternative for riders who want lighter weight without paying premium titanium prices.
